Use your insurance benefits before December 31!
Almost all insurance plans reset on a calendar year. Any applied deductible amounts, out-of-pocket max, visit allowances, and even unused FSA plan dollar amounts do not roll over to the next benefit year. What does this mean? If you don’t use it, you lose it!

How Can Choosing Physical Therapy Save Time?
Time is arguably the most valuable thing in life, and many would agree that time is money. When you let an injury go, your body will compensate for that injury more and more. Even day-to-day movements (let alone sports and higher-level activities) will put more stress on the injury. Worse yet, those persistent compensations can lead to pain in other areas of the body. Simply put, the longer you let an injury go, the longer it will take to recover.
